7***@qq.com
7***@qq.com
  • 发布:2019-12-29 16:07
  • 更新:2019-12-29 16:07
  • 阅读:754

#插件讨论# 【 List 列表 - DCloud 】click switchChange 事件互不干扰 如何处理?

分类:uni-app

描述:click switchChange 都绑定了事件, switch触发的同时也会触发了click 期望:click switchChange 事件互不干扰 如何处理?

@click="read()"
@switchChange.stop="swtichChange"

这么写的话,点击切换switch,会直接报错,而且read也触发了
index.umd.min.js:1 [system] TypeError: $event.stopPropagation is not a function
at switchChange (edit.vue?e5ff:81)
at invokeWithErrorHandling (vue.runtime.esm.js:1865)
at VueComponent.invoker (vue.runtime.esm.js:2190)
at invokeWithErrorHandling (vue.runtime.esm.js:1865)
at VueComponent.Vue.$emit (vue.runtime.esm.js:3898)
at VueComponent.Vue.<computed> [as $emit] (backend.js:1793)
at VueComponent.onSwitchChange (uni-list-item.vue:122)
at change (uni-list-item.vue?4c3a:97)
at invokeWithErrorHandling (vue.runtime.esm.js:1865)
at VueComponent.invoker (vue.runtime.esm.js:2190)

2019-12-29 16:07 负责人:无 分享
已邀请:

该问题目前已经被锁定, 无法添加新回复